Conduct a Thorough Roof Inspection

A thorough roof inspection is a vital step in preparing your claim, making sure you have an accurate understanding of the damage. Start by examining your roofing materials, looking for missing, cracked, or curling shingles, damaged flashing, or signs of wear.

Use an inspection checklist to stay organized and guarantee you don’t miss any issues. Check for granule loss in shingles, rust on metal components, and any sagging or water stains inside your attic.

Conduct this inspection carefully, both from the ground and on the roof if safe, so you can clearly identify all damage before filing your claim. Trusted roofing experts can assist in ensuring your inspection is thorough and accurate.

Document Damage With Photos and Videos

Capturing clear and detailed photos and videos of the damage is essential to support your insurance claim. Use your smartphone or camera to document affected areas from multiple angles, highlighting the extent of the damage.

Drone footage and aerial surveys provide a valuable aerial perspective, especially for hard-to-reach or extensive roof damage. These visuals can help insurance adjusters accurately assess the situation.

Make certain your images are well-lit and in focus, capturing close-up details and overall views. Proper documentation with photos and videos strengthens your claim and speeds up the approval process, giving you confidence your roof damage is thoroughly recorded.

Gather Relevant Maintenance and Repair Records

Gathering your maintenance and repair records provides important context for your insurance claim. Keep detailed logs of roof maintenance, including inspections, cleaning, and upgrades, as well as any repair records.

These documents demonstrate your proactive efforts to maintain your roof’s condition and may help explain the timing of damage. Providing clear, organized records can strengthen your case by showing consistent roof upkeep and identifying potential issues.

Make sure to gather receipts, work orders, and inspection reports related to your roof. Having this information ready will streamline the claims process and support your case for a timely, fair settlement.

Prepare a Detailed Estimate of Repair Costs

Creating a detailed estimate of repair costs is essential to supporting your insurance claim and guaranteeing you receive adequate coverage. When preparing your repair estimate, include all necessary repairs identified during the inspection, such as roofing materials, labor, and potential additional damages.

Present this estimate clearly to the insurance adjuster, emphasizing the scope of work required. A complete repair estimate helps the insurance adjuster understand the full extent of the damage and ensures your claim reflects actual costs.

Be precise, itemize expenses, and gather supporting documentation. This thorough approach increases the likelihood of a smooth claim process and fair reimbursement for your roof replacement.
